Understanding Melatonin’s Impact on Circadian Rhythm and Athletic Performance
Melatonin is a hormone that plays a crucial role in regulating sleep-wake cycles, commonly referred to as the circadian rhythm. This rhythm is a natural process that influences physical, mental, and behavioral changes in a 24-hour cycle. Melatonin levels rise in the evening, signaling the body that it’s time to prepare for sleep. In athletes, maintaining a natural circadian rhythm is vital for ensuring optimal performance and recovery. Poor sleep quality can lead to decreased athletic performance, increased fatigue, and delayed recovery times. Disruption in the sleep cycle can also negatively impact mood and cognitive function, which are essential for athletes. Therefore, understanding melatonin’s role in sleep is fundamental for athletes regulating their performance. Many athletes struggle with insomnia or restless nights due to various stresses, leading to a reliance on supplements to bolster melatonin levels. Supplementation can assist in reinforcing the body’s natural melatonin production, thereby improving sleep quality. However, it is essential to consult with a healthcare professional before starting any supplementation, ensuring the correct dosage and timing to achieve the desired effects on sleep and performance.
The Science Behind Melatonin Secretion
The production of melatonin is closely linked to light exposure and darkness. The pineal gland secretes melatonin in response to darkness, and this process is inhibited by light. The retinal cells in our eyes send signals to the suprachiasmatic nucleus (SCN) in the brain, which acts like a master clock, regulating when melatonin is released. This relationship highlights the importance of light exposure for athletic training, especially for those who train during evenings or under artificially lit environments. To optimize athletic performance, it is essential to maintain exposure to natural light during the day while minimizing artificial light exposure in the evening. Proper scheduling of training can positively impact melatonin levels and, subsequently, sleep quality. This alignment allows athletes to harness the benefits of melatonin for recovery after strenuous workouts, helping to repair and rebuild muscle tissues. Furthermore, understanding how melatonin secretion works can aid in the development of light therapy strategies for athletes, particularly those who may travel across time zones, thereby minimizing disruptions to their sleep and performance.
Effects of Melatonin Supplementation on Athletic Performance
Research indicates that melatonin supplementation can enhance sleep quality and duration, which is essential for athletes seeking to maximize their recovery potential. Improved sleep can lead to better performance outcomes, as athletes are more rested and better able to focus during their training sessions and competitions. Supplementing with melatonin can help those who struggle with sleep onset or maintenance, providing an effective tool to counteract the effects of travel or competition stressors that may disrupt normal sleep patterns. Studies have shown that athletes reported enhanced recovery, reduced fatigue, and improved mood after using melatonin as part of their sleep regimen. However, the timing and dosage of melatonin supplementation are crucial for maximizing its benefits. Athletes are advised to take melatonin approximately 30 minutes before bedtime and start with a lower dosage to assess tolerance. Over time, adjustments can be made based on individual responses. Still, excessive use of melatonin can lead to dependence or impair the body’s natural production of the hormone. Therefore, athletes should approach supplementation judiciously.
Melatonin’s Role in Recovery Processes
During sleep, the body undergoes critical processes essential for physical and mental recovery, including muscle repair, hormone regulation, and the consolidation of memory. Melatonin plays a pivotal role in enhancing these recovery processes by promoting deeper sleep stages, particularly slow-wave sleep (SWS), which is associated with physical restoration. Not only does adequate sleep help repair muscles after strenuous exercise, but it also supports immune function and reduces inflammation, both vital for athletic performance. Melatonin can act as a powerful antioxidant, combating oxidative stress that accumulates from intense physical activity. This added protection may contribute to faster recovery times and decrease the risk of injury over time. Moreover, melatonin’s ability to regulate various hormones, including cortisol, indicates its favorable influence on stress management in athletes. Elevated levels of cortisol during periods of intense training may be detrimental to overall performance and recovery. Therefore, proper sleep hygiene, alongside melatonin supplementation when necessary, can be a key strategy for athletes focusing on recovery and maintaining peak performance throughout their training regimens.
Impact of Sleep Disorders on Athletic Performance
Sleep disorders such as insomnia, sleep apnea, and restless legs syndrome can significantly impede an athlete’s performance and recovery. Athletes often work under rigorous training schedules, which may contribute to or exacerbate sleep-related concerns. These disorders can lead to reduced sleep quality, negatively affecting coordination, decision-making, and reaction time. Furthermore, chronic sleep deprivation can suppress the immune system, making athletes more susceptible to illnesses. It is crucial for athletes to recognize the signs of sleep disorders and seek professional treatment if needed. Solutions might include cognitive behavioral therapy (CBT), lifestyle changes, and, in some cases, the use of sleep aids or melatonin supplements. Awareness of the importance of sleep quality empowers athletes to take proactive steps towards ensuring better rest and recovery. By prioritizing sleep and addressing any underlying issues, athletes stand to benefit from improved performance and overall health. Strategies for Optimizing Sleep
To optimize sleep quality and therefore improve athletic performance, several strategies can be implemented. Firstly, establishing a regular sleep schedule is essential; going to bed and waking up at the same time every day helps regulate the body’s internal clock. Secondly, creating a sleep-friendly environment by minimizing noise, light, and ensuring a comfortable temperature can significantly enhance sleep quality. Utilizing relaxing bedtime rituals, such as reading or gentle stretching, may also prepare the body for sleep. It’s beneficial to avoid stimulants like caffeine, nicotine, and heavy meals close to bedtime. Additionally, limiting screen time from phones and computers, which emit blue light, can further support melatonin production. Athletes should consider incorporating relaxation techniques, such as meditation or deep breathing exercises, to help alleviate stress before bed. Tracking sleep patterns through apps or journals allows athletes to identify patterns and make adjustments accordingly. These strategies, when combined with an understanding of melatonin’s role, can significantly impact recovery periods, enabling athletes to reap enhanced performance benefits on the track, field, or court.
